Post subject:  Support for additional keys in gestures

Okay so the reason I want to suggest this is simply because so many viewers (basically all but official) do this to an extent. While I doubt this will be accepted I'd like to point out some possible concerns and how they aren't handled in other viewers.
So, when it comes to key conflicts... Turns out none of the viewers handle this. They actively conflict with movement keys if an active gesture uses that key.
Also, unlike other viewers I only added the Space, 0-9 and A-Z keys as options. All of the keys I added work as expected.
When typing in a field these keys do not conflict.
While this is non-compliant it is a very common feature. Any conflicts that I found (I've been using a modified viewer with this patch) are also in all other viewers.
This would simply be nice to have because it makes it easier to handle gestures that use those keys (they work even without the UI supporting it). This also allows you to properly see these shortcuts in the preview/edit panel/floater.

Sorry, this will not be accepted.

Allowing gesture shortcuts that would potentially collide with viewer shortcuts would just make things more confusing than they are (with window manager shortcuts & Co).
